Expert Medical Testimony

Asbestos lawyers need the experience and knowledge to assist their clients in obtaining compensation for diseases caused by asbestos exposure. To build their cases, they often use expert witnesses. An expert witness is a professional who has special knowledge, training, or skills in relation to the subject of the case (in this case mesothelioma and asbestos exposure). Expert witnesses assist jurors and judges understand the complexity of topics that are beyond the reach of ordinary knowledge.

A radiologist could, for instance, testify about mesothelioma-related symptoms, such as chest pain or difficulty breathing, by comparing the results of X rays and CT scans, which reveal scarring in the lung tissue due to asbestos exposure. Mesothelioma doctors may also testify about how asbestos may cause certain kinds of mesothelioma as well as other health issues.

Experts can be utilized by mesothelioma attorneys to prove that their client is entitled to financial compensation through asbestos bankruptcy trusts and personal injury lawsuits or other legal options. The type of compensation that a person can receive is contingent on their particular situation and may include money to pay for funeral expenses, medical bills and loss of income and more.

Many asbestos lawyer lawyers are experienced in filing lawsuits on behalf victims of mesothelioma and other asbestos diseases, as and other types of personal injury. They can help their clients throughout the process and can answer all questions.

Mesothelioma firms with good reputation have national databases which can assist in determining the place where a patient has been exposed to asbestos. They can also gather affidavits from past coworkers to prove that they were exposed. Due to the latency period of asbestos-related illnesses, it is difficult for patients remembering exactly where and when asbestos products were employed.

A seasoned mesothelioma lawyer may also hire a private investigator to help uncover information that will enhance their case. This could include finding documents or memos that prove asbestos companies were aware of the dangers their products posed but didn't warn workers or the general public. This evidence can be used in an action to prove negligence and obtain compensation. Many lawyers charge a percentage of the amount received by the victim instead of charging a fee upfront. This is referred to as a contingency fee and it can help people avoid having to pay legal bills.

Statute of limitations

A statute of limitations is the date that an asbestos victim or a family member, must file a lawsuit. The statute of limitations is different from one state to the next and from case to case. The defendants in an asbestos claim are often quick to remind the claimant that the statute of limitations has expired and the claimant is no longer entitled to sue.

A mesothelioma specialist lawyer will help determine what statute of limitations applies in a particular situation. This is essential because the statute of limitations starts to tick when the diagnosis is made for personal injury claims, and also when a death occurs for wrongful death cases.

There are many factors that can affect the time limit for a statute of limitations, such as where the exposure occurred and where the victim resided and worked throughout their entire life and where the company responsible for the production of asbestos-containing products was located. The number of asbestos-related diseases diagnosed also plays a role in the possibility that more than one disease can be tied to one exposure.

Another factor that can influence how quickly the statute-of-limitations clock starts is the discovery rule. This rule states that the statute begins to run when it is reasonable for the victim to know that their exposure to asbestos had caused a health issue. Due to the long interval between exposure and the first signs of symptoms, it is likely that the majority of asbestos victims didn't realize that they had suffered from an asbestos-related ailment until decades after their first exposure.

Exceptions, exemptions and unique situations can allow an asbestos attorney to start an action after the deadline for filing a lawsuit has passed. If the time-limit has already expired in a case, a specialized mesothelioma attorney will assist the victim and their family to explore different avenues to obtain financial compensation.

Asbestos lawyers can also help those who need help with trust fund claims. These claims are a civil action that allows claimants to get compensation from asbestos funds set up by the manufacturers responsible for their exposure. These trusts are intended to help victims and their families with money for funeral expenses, medical bills and loss of income and other damages.

How to File a Claim

When an asbestos attorney has gathered all evidence relevant to the case and evidence, they file the initial complaint, also referred to as a pleading, in the court. This document will detail the facts of your case and provide the evidence supporting the claims. After the pleading has been filed, the defendant will have an opportunity to reply. An experienced lawyer will be able anticipate and prepare for any legal issues.

After filing the initial claim, an attorney will collaborate with medical experts to determine the connection between your exposure to asbestos and your condition. This is a crucial step in any asbestos case. It is difficult to obtain an adequate amount of compensation without medical expert testimony.

Typically, asbestos victims are seeking financial compensation for their lost wages medical expenses, and other expenses associated with their mesothelioma diagnose. An experienced asbestos attorney will help victims pursue the right kind of legal action in order to maximize their chances of obtaining compensation. This could include a workers compensation suit, but this could not be the most appropriate alternative if your exposure happened at a workplace that no longer exists or when your employer failed to adequately warn you about asbestos' dangers.

You may be able to file an asbestos trust fund claim or even a lawsuit against the asbestos-manufacturing companies that exposed you to toxic asbestos. A seasoned lawyer will be aware of other options that may be open to you. For instance, if are a veteran and you have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ease, you might be eligible to receive VA disability benefits.

Choosing an Attorney

The best way to seek compensation from asbestos producers is to work with the best mesothelioma lawyers. These firms are licensed to practice in all 50 states and have decades of expertise in the legal systems of every state. They are able to determine where to bring a lawsuit in accordance with the statute of limitations and other legal issues. Medical experts are also counseled by mesothelioma lawyers who are experienced to assist them in assembling and present complicated information.

A mesothelioma lawyer should be up-to-date on the latest legal developments, including precedents in cases and other cases that may affect a client's claim. They will also be acquainted with the specifics of medical records and will be able to discern unfamiliar medical jargon. An attorney with an experience in the construction industry and can understand the technical aspects of asbestos exposure is important. This is because asbestos victims often have worked in fields like shipyard repair heating systems as well as in the automotive industry, and the Navy in which asbestos was employed in numerous construction projects.

Mesothelioma lawyers can help clients to file an action or trust fund claim in order to obtain financial compensation for their injuries. The asbestos companies are sued for exposing the victim to asbestos. A lawsuit can offer compensation for funeral costs, medical expenses, costs, lost income and other expenses. If a loved one dies from an asbestos-related illness, asbestos victims can file an action for wrongful death.
